Abstract

INTRODUCTION: Histopathological grading depends on several features, of which appearance of mitotic figures and apoptotic bodies in the tissue sections plays an important role. The mitotic figures and apoptotic bodies help assess the cellular proliferation and the turnover of the tumor. As mitotic figures (MF) and apoptotic bodies are difficult to assess under routine H and E sections, other methods such as immunohistochemistry (IHC) and flow cytometry have been implemented but, these methods are expensive and more time-consuming and are highly technique sensitive. Hence, stains, which should be cheap, and can be used routinely, and can be tried in identifying the mitotic figures and apoptotic bodies, which has come out with a better result. Routine histological procedures cannot differentiate between pyknotic nuclei, apoptotic cells and MFs which makes the diagnosis difficult.
 MATERIAL AND METHODS: Study samples were divided in to 3 groups, group 1- case group in which 40 samples of paraffin blocks diagnosed as oral epithelial dysplasia (OED) and oral squamous cell carcinoma (OSCC) and group 2- control group in which 40 samples from the healthy individuals. 5 micron thickness sections were made from each tissue specimen. One section was stained with H & E stain nd another section was stained with 1% crystal violet stain.
 RESULTS: In case group there were 24(60%) male and 16(40%) female while in control group there were 22 (55%) male and 18(45%) female. Mean age in case group was 36.2±15.4 and in control group was25.7±12.7. There is a significant increase in mitotic figures of H & E (P< 0.01) and crystal violet (P < 0.01). In case, there was a significant (P<0.05) increase in mitotic figures when stained with crystal violet. As compared to H&E stain there was a significant (P < 0.01) increase in metaphase observed in crystal violet stain. Mean mitotic figure by H&E in case group was 4.15±1.07 while in crystal violet it was 5.97±1.87.
 CONCLUSION: % crystal violet stain is the cheaper stain and can be performed in small laboratories and resource constraint settings. Crystal violet can be used for the localization of mitotic figures and assessing proliferation.
